Understanding Bifold Doors
Bifold doors include multiple panels that are hinged together and can be opened in a concertina design. They are generally made from various products such as wood, aluminum, or uPVC, each offering unique advantages. While bifold doors can transform areas perfectly, their installation can be complex, needing precision and skill.
Advantages of Bifold Doors
Space Efficiency: Bifold doors are ideal for maximizing space. When opened, they slide neatly against the wall, releasing up space and allowing for an unobstructed view.

Natural Light: These doors frequently feature large panes of glass that can flood your home with natural light, creating a warm and welcoming environment.

Flexible Designs: Bifold doors come in various materials and finishes, allowing house owners to pick choices that best fit their home's aesthetic.

Increased Home Value: Quality bifold doors can increase a home's market price. Their modern-day look and functionality interest prospective purchasers.

The length of time does it generally take to install bifold doors?
The installation duration can vary based upon the door size and intricacy of the job. However, a professional installation typically takes between 1 to 3 days.
2. Can I install bifold doors myself?
While some homeowners might attempt DIY setups, it is not advised due to the complexity and accuracy required. Employing a certified professional makes sure the job is done properly.
3. What is the typical cost of working with a certified bifold door installer?
Expenses can vary extensively based on place, door type, and installer experience. Typically, property owners may expect to invest in between 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 for installation labor alone.
4. Do bifold doors require unique maintenance?
Bifold doors need routine cleansing and periodic lubrication of the tracks and hinges. The specific maintenance requirements can depend upon the materials used.
5. What kind of guarantee is typical for bifold doors?
Service warranties differ by producer and can vary from a couple of years to a life time on the door's structural integrity, but the installation work normally has a different warranty supplied by the installer.
